Description

The most fun toy for me was the guitar.
And that continues to this day.

An autobiography that looks back on the life of PATA, who is famous as the guitarist of the legendary band X JAPAN.
This book is a must-read for fans of both PATA and X JAPAN, covering everything from his childhood encounters with music and guitar to his whirlwind period of activity as X JAPAN, traveling the world.
There is also a special feature on PATA's favorite guitars.



Chapter 1: Childhood? Encounter with the guitar
Born in Chiba City, Chiba Prefecture in 1965 / He was obsessed with playing with supercar erasers / His father as a teacher seen through his students / His life was even in danger!? The so-called soba incident / He went on to junior high school and joined the tennis club / We were really a bunch of idiots / He encountered Western rock music and the guitar / His father suddenly passed away. And then he longed for the electric guitar

Chapter 2: The beginning of band activities Forming his first band / Visiting Dancing Mothers / Tadaya, which led to various connections / Getting to know YOSHIKI

Chapter 3: Joining X? Hating recording until they became a legendary band / His first live performance with X / Saying "yes" was the end of his luck / A self-made tour / A true collaborative effort / Troubles behind the scenes / Groping for visuals / How "BLUE BLOOD" was made / Heading to the long-awaited Budokan / It's like the start of a black market mafia deal... / As long as the guitar sounds good, that's all that matters / The biggest live performance in the band's history / Taiji's departure / Aiming for Mother Farm / The production of his solo album "PATA" / Solo album tour / X becomes X JAPAN / Anecdotes surrounding "ART OF LIFE" / Living in two places: Japan and LA / Words exchanged after the last live performance

Chapter 4: HIDE's Death? Activities as Ra:IN
Farewell to HIDE / That band with an embarrassing name / The mediator for Dope HEADz / The beginning of Ra:IN / Ra:IN is the most band-like thing. / My favorite amp: Marshall MKII Super Lead 100

Chapter 5: X JAPAN Reunites? And What's Next?
A message from YOSHIKI announcing the "reunion" / The people in front of me who are happy to hear the music / SUGIZO becomes an official member / Reuniting with a Marshall amp in an unexpected place!? / 2016, when he suffered a serious illness / HEATH is a kind guy / As THE LAST ROCKSTARS / His relationship with the guitar remains unchanged / His beloved guitar
